The automotive micro switch market refers to the segment focused on the production and supply of small, reliable switches used in various automotive applications. These switches are integral to systems like door latches, seat adjustments, lighting, and safety features such as airbags. Automotive microswitches are known for their compact size, durability, and ability to handle high electrical loads. As the automotive industry moves towards more advanced technologies, such as electric vehicles (EVs) and autonomous driving systems, the demand for these switches is increasing, driving innovation and growth in the market.

Micro switches are becoming increasingly crucial in enhancing the safety and reliability of electric vehicles (EVs). Key trends include their use in battery management systems for precise monitoring of charging, discharging, and thermal conditions, ensuring optimal battery performance. They're also integral to the operation of safety features like airbags, seatbelt sensors, and electronic parking brakes. Additionally, micro switches enable enhanced user control in systems such as power windows, doors, and lighting. As EVs advance, micro switches are evolving to meet stringent durability, precision, and miniaturization requirements, contributing to overall vehicle performance, safety, and reliability.

According to Cognitive Market Research, Subminiature microswitches dominate the automotive microswitch market due to their compact size, durability, and reliability in harsh environments. These switches are ideal for space-constrained applications such as door latches, seat position sensors, and safety systems. Their ability to withstand vibrations, temperature extremes, and frequent use makes them a preferred choice for automotive manufacturers. Moreover, subminiature microswitches offer high precision, ensuring consistent performance in critical automotive functions. The growing demand for smaller, more efficient electronic components in modern vehicles further drives their dominance in the market, meeting both performance and space-saving requirements.

According to Cognitive Market Research, Door locks and latches significantly dominate the automotive micro switch market due to their essential role in vehicle security and functionality. Microswitches are integral in detecting the position of doors and latches, ensuring proper locking mechanisms, and enhancing safety features like airbags and power windows. As automotive manufacturers increasingly adopt advanced electronic systems for security and convenience, the demand for reliable micro switches in locking and latching systems grows. Additionally, the shift toward electric vehicles and smart automotive technologies further drives the need for high-performance, durable microswitches in these critical components.
